Intercure Ltd. reported Q2 2023 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.105, significantly beating the consensus estimate of $0.0816 by 28.68%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in the available data, limiting top-line comparisons. The stock responded positively, gaining 15.31% on the announcement.

Intercure Ltd., a leading cannabis company operating primarily in Israel, delivered a robust bottom-line performance in the second quarter. The EPS of $0.105 marks a notable improvement over the prior quarter’s results, likely driven by operational efficiencies, favorable product mix, and disciplined cost management. While no segment-level revenue breakdown was provided, the company’s focus on premium medical cannabis products and its expanding domestic market share may have contributed to margin expansion. The 28.68% earnings surprise suggests that management successfully navigated supply chain dynamics and regulatory hurdles. The company’s strong cash flow generation from operations also likely supported profitability. However, without revenue data, investors cannot assess whether the beat was volume-driven or price-driven. Intercure continues to invest in cultivation capacity and R&D, which may support long-term earnings stability. The overall operational highlights point to a company that is managing costs effectively despite a competitive landscape.

Intercure did not issue formal forward guidance with its Q2 release, but the EPS beat provides a positive near-term outlook. The company may benefit from continued normalization of Israel’s medical cannabis regulations and potential expansion into export markets. Strategic priorities likely include increasing patient access through pharmacies and digital platforms, as well as optimizing cultivation yields. Risks to these expectations include potential regulatory delays, pricing pressure from local competitors, and macroeconomic headwinds in Israel. Additionally, the lack of revenue disclosure raises caution; future quarters may require more transparency to maintain investor confidence. Management anticipates that ongoing investments in cultivation and extraction technology could lower production costs over time. Nonetheless, the cannabis sector remains volatile, and Intercure’s ability to sustain profitability amid shifting market conditions is not guaranteed. Investors should monitor upcoming regulatory milestones and the company’s quarterly filings for updated growth expectations.

The 15.31% share price jump following the earnings release reflects strong market approval of the EPS beat. Analysts may revise EPS estimates upward given the surprise, though the absence of revenue data tempers enthusiasm. Some brokerages might highlight the earnings momentum as a positive catalyst for a stock that has faced volatility. Key factors to watch in the coming months include the company’s next quarterly report—where revenue figures are anticipated—and any updates on international expansion plans. The stock’s reaction suggests that investors are prioritizing bottom-line results over top-line visibility for now. However, sustained price appreciation will likely require consistent earnings beats and clearer revenue growth signals. The upcoming quarters could serve as a litmus test for Intercure’s business model resilience. Overall, the Q2 outcome positions the company favorably in the competitive cannabis space, but cautious observation is warranted.
